Ground Zero is on our list, & Statue of Liberty we make take a harbor cruise rather than fight the crowds. I guess we will be seeing it when we set sail too. I ride as much as I can - walking is difficult for me. Rheumatoid Arthritis takes it's toll!

There was an article in the travel section of Sunday's paper that gave some ideas on where to go & stay in NY. There is a good map put out by the MTA - info at www.mta.com . Also, if you stay in Manhattan the Buckingham Hotel across from Carnegie Hall was recommended. One bedroom suite with extra foldout bed for $269.00 per nite plus tax. I think we will be staying the airport Mariott & taxi over to the port. It's not as if we have to decide right now! But I like to plan ahead.
